Management Commentary
During the accompanying the previous quarter earnings call, DRVN leadership focused on operational efficiency improvements rolled out across its franchise network in recent months, including standardized supply chain agreements that reduce input costs for both company-owned and franchise locations. Management highlighted stable demand for collision repair services through the quarter, noting that utilization rates for that segment remained consistent amid broader macroeconomic conditions. Leadership also addressed the absence of published revenue figures, stating that the company is finalizing segment-level reporting adjustments related to recently completed franchise portfolio acquisitions, with full financial disclosures set to be included in upcoming regulatory filings. The team also noted that recurring revenue from subscription-based car wash membership programs continued to perform as expected, with customer retention rates for the product line holding steady through the quarter.

Forward Guidance
Driven Brands did not share formal quantitative forward guidance alongside its the previous quarter earnings release, per an updated disclosure policy the company announced in recent weeks. Instead, leadership shared qualitative outlook insights, noting that the firm will continue pursuing targeted franchise acquisition opportunities in high-growth geographic markets, while investing in digital tools to streamline customer booking and reduce service turnaround times across all segments. Management noted that potential headwinds including fluctuations in raw material costs for automotive repair parts and rising hourly labor costs could impact operating margins in upcoming periods, though the company has active cost-mitigation strategies in place to offset these pressures. The team also added that long-term industry fundamentals remain supportive, as elevated new vehicle prices have led many consumers to hold onto existing vehicles for longer, driving sustained demand for after-market automotive services.

Market Reaction
Following the the previous quarter earnings release, trading in DRVN shares saw above-average volume in recent sessions, as investors digested the partial financial disclosures and management commentary. Analysts covering the stock have largely held off on updating their published research notes until full revenue and segment performance data is released, though many noted that the reported EPS figure aligns with prior market expectations. Some market participants have expressed cautious optimism regarding the company’s updates on recurring subscription revenue and operational efficiency gains, while others have cited the delayed full financial disclosure as a source of near-term uncertainty that could contribute to elevated share price volatility in upcoming sessions. Industry analysts tracking the automotive after-market sector have noted that DRVN’s reported EPS trends are broadly consistent with peer group results for the same quarter, with most sector operators reporting EPS near consensus estimates.
